TLDR : Answer Summary
The original poster reported confusion over receiving a 1,000 THB fine during a 90-day reporting for their visa. Despite having a valid visa stamp from July 2021 to July 2022, the user was informed that the 90-day reporting cycle is separate from the visa extension period, leading to their fine. Community responses indicated that the timing of the 90-day report and visa extension are distinct, and reminded the poster to consult more details about their stamps for clarity.
